Development and Application of an Intervention for Noise Reduction in Intensive Care Units

Abstract
Purpose: This study aimed to develop an intervention to reduce noise in the Intensive Care Unit (ICU) and evaluatethe effects of applying it.

Methods: The research design was a non-equivalent control group quasi-experimentalstudy. To develop noise reduction interventions in ICUs, preliminary intervention techniques to reduce noise werederived through a literature review, field survey, and focus group interviews. The intervention was developed byverifying the validity of the content and the clinical applicability, and the result was applied to practice. To assessthe effect of the intervention, the following were evaluated: noise level in the ICU, perceived noise level, responseto noise, satisfaction of patients and staff with noise management, sleep quality of patients, noise-relatedknowledge, and perception and performance of noise management of the staff.
Results: With the interventiondeveloped in this study, the noise level in the ICU, perceived noise level, and response to noise of patients andstaff decreased, and satisfaction with noise management increased. The sleep quality of patients, noise-relatedknowledge, and perception and performance of noise management of the staff increased.

Conclusion: Thisintervention is shown to be effective in reducing the noise level in the ICU. Therefore, if it is used actively in practice,it is expected to create a comfortable environment by reducing the noise level in the ICU.
